Gay Geeks (and Transformers) for LGBT Pride


This Saturday, December 8, 2012, is this year's annual Metro Manila Pride March. Instead of the past venues like Malate or Quezon City, this year's :LGBT Pride March will be held at Makati City - which is kind of a big things since this is pretty much the business capital of the country.

In honor of the big march (and because I enjoy playing with my Transformers), I took the time to get some of my robots together for a quick photo shoot in an attempt to recreate the LGBT Pride Flag with their colors. And yes, the combination of Optimus Prime, Wheelie, Bumblebee, Hound, Soundwave and Shockwave roughly correspond to the flag colors of Red, Orange, Yellow, Green, Blue and Purple.

And why use Transformers? Besides the fact that I have so many of them, you have to admit there are bound to be a lot of potentially gay robots in the ranks. I mean seriously, with less than 10 female Transformers on all of Cybertron, what else are those robots going to do?
